2. Regulatory Compliance & Japanese Market Specifications

Entering the Japanese construction supply chain requires strict compliance with domestic standards. Foremost among these is the regulation of formaldehyde emissions, a primary VOC targeted by the Ministry of Land, Infrastructure, Transport and Tourism (MLIT). Adhesives used in interior residential or commercial fittings must meet the prestigious F★★★★ (F-Four-Star) rating. This standard requires that formaldehyde emission rates do not exceed 0.005 mg/m²h, ensuring optimal indoor air quality (IAQ) and protecting occupants from Sick Building Syndrome (SBS).

Furthermore, structural adhesives must align with Japanese Industrial Standards (JIS), specifically JIS A 5538 (Adhesives for floor finishing) and JIS A 5758 for architectural sealants. Chemical Composition Shifts: Polyurethane, Acrylic, and MS Polymers

The choice of polymer backbone determines the suitability of nail-free adhesives for specific applications. Water-based acrylic adhesives offer excellent ecological profiles, low VOC levels, and quick paintability, making them ideal for indoor drywall and trim installations. However, for structural elements exposed to moisture and mechanical stress, silane-modified polyethers (MS Polymers) are preferred. MS Polymer technology combines the UV resistance of silicones with the mechanical strength of polyurethanes, while remaining completely isocyanate-free. Q1: What are the differences between solvent-based and water-based nail-free glues? +
Solvent-based nail-free adhesives provide quick initial grab and form high-strength bonds on challenging surfaces, including metals, plastics, and brickwork. However, they contain volatile organic compounds (VOCs). Water-based acrylic adhesives offer a very low VOC profile, clean up easily with water, and are paintable. They are designed for interior applications like drywall and trim, where F★★★★ compliance and indoor air quality are key requirements.

Q4: What is the typical curing timeline for heavy-duty structural nail-free glue? +
Our formulas develop initial skin formation within 5 to 15 minutes, with a load-bearing tack achieved in 1 to 2 hours. Full cure occurs at a rate of approximately 2-3 mm per 24 hours under standard room conditions (23°C and 50% relative humidity). Curing may take longer in dry or low-temperature environments.

Q7: Are these adhesives compatible with alkaline concrete substrates? +
Our MS Polymer and polyurethane formulations are chemically neutral and resistant to alkaline substances. Unlike acidic adhesives, they will not react with or lose adhesion on concrete, masonry, or cement boards.
